When considering the finest cpus for a gaming PC, the option can be discouraging as a result of the myriad of options offered, each boasting ingenious features and enhanced performance metrics. AMD and Intel are the dominant gamers in this area, frequently striving to produce the most effective and powerful chips. AMD's Ryzen 9 7950X and the Intel Core i9-13900K are among the top contenders, providing superior multi-threaded efficiency which is essential for managing requiring video gaming experiences and multitasking atmospheres. These processors come furnished with high core and thread matters, large cache sizes, and impressive clock speeds that push the limits of pc gaming efficiency, allowing gamers to delight in high frame rates and smooth graphics. While Ryzen cpus have a reputation for being much more affordable while supplying similar, otherwise premium, efficiency throughout a number of metrics, Intel's recent advancements in hybrid style and power performance are similarly compelling. Hence, the choice of a video gaming CPU mainly depends upon the specific demands, whether that be worth, overall efficiency, or extra features like incorporated graphics or overclocking prospective.
